203. Nursing Service Providers; Licensed Practical Nurse
[An individual with post-high school vocational training and practical experience in the provision of nursing care at a level less than that required for certification as a Registered Nurse. Requirements for education, experience, licensure, and job responsibilities vary among the states. ( HL7V3.0 )] (UMLS (HL7) C1554543) =Professional or Occupational Group =HealthcareProviderTaxonomyHIPAA;

204. Nursing Service Providers; Licensed Vocational Nurse
[An individual with post-high school vocational training and practical experience in the provision of nursing care at a level less than that required for certification as a Registered Nurse. [An alternate term for licensed practical nurse arising from difference in occupational titles between states and post-high school training programs and institutions.] Requirements for education, experience, licensure, and job responsibilities vary among the states. ( HL7V3.0 )] (UMLS (HL7) C1554544) =Professional or Occupational Group =HealthcareProviderTaxonomyHIPAA;

266. Nursing Service Related Providers; Nurse's Aide
[(1) An unlicensed individual who is trained to function in an assistive role to the licensed nurse in the provision of patient/client activities as delegated by the nurse; (2) An individual trained (either on-the-job or through a formal course generally of less than one year) and experienced in performing patient or client-care nursing tasks that do not require the skills of a specialist, technician, or professional. Examples of tasks performed by nurses aides include changing clothes, diapers, and beds; assisting patients to perform exercises or personal hygiene tasks, and supporting communication or social interaction. Specific education and credentials are not required for this work. ( HL7V3.0 )] (UMLS (HL7) C1554605) =Professional or Occupational Group =HealthcareProviderTaxonomyHIPAA;

284. nutrient interaction
[physical chemical interaction between nutrients, or between nutrients and other components of the diet or other compounds, including desirable or undesirable results; nutrients are substances that can be metabolized by an organism to give energy and build tissue; for the concept of nutrients interacting with drugs use NUTRIENT DRUG INTERACTION. ( CSP )] (UMLS (CSP) C0242784) =Natural Phenomenon or Process ;
